    Conveniently there have been recent comparables to Urruti in the market.

    1. Ramirez (27 years old, 600k salary, 23 goals/57 games) - moved for ~800k

    2. Nemeth (29 years old, 1m salary, 12 goals/58 games) - moved for 350k and first round pick

    I think it's safe to say he's not moving for Ramirez money but def not below Nemeth. Somewhere around 500-600k I think would be fair market value.
